When everyone is learning the piano, don't get the order wrong. Learning the piano requires tranquility and taking it step by step. Learning the piano cannot be achieved overnight. When practicing the piano, you should first understand the piano, its notes, and the sound production principle. Understanding these will give you a head start over others. Now let's see where we should start.
1.Know the keyboard
2.Beat and rhythm
3.Solfege and ear training
4.Basic hand shape
5.Finger strengthening training
6.Interval foundation
7.Triad
8.Seventh chord
9.Inversion of chords
10.Suspended chord
11.Chord progression
12.Melody and accompaniment
13.Transformation of 24 keys
14.Application of major and minor harmony
15.Application of major and minor melody
16.Scale running
17.Arpeggio position
18.Descending chromatic scale
19.Transposition design
20.Chord + rhythm
21.Mixed complex rhythm
22.Sight-reading training
